deselction automatique menu deroulant

deselction automatique menu deroulant - HTML/CSS - Programmation

Marsh Posté le 09-01-2005 à 18:02:04    

Salut,
voir menu en haut à droite dans ce site : http://www.surfstation.lu/.
Quand vous selectionner une rubrique dans ce menu et que vous voulez utilisez la roulette de la souris pour le scroll de la page, vous changez de rubrique sans le vouloir...
Existe-t-il un moyen de deselectionner automatiquement une fois la rubrique choisie?
Merci

Reply

Marsh Posté le 09-01-2005 à 18:02:04   

Reply

Marsh Posté le 09-01-2005 à 18:15:23    

kameha a écrit :

Salut,
voir menu en haut à droite dans ce site : http://www.surfstation.lu/.
Quand vous selectionner une rubrique dans ce menu et que vous voulez utilisez la roulette de la souris pour le scroll de la page, vous changez de rubrique sans le vouloir...
Existe-t-il un moyen de deselectionner automatiquement une fois la rubrique choisie?
Merci


 
Je n'ai pas ce problème avec mozilla, mais tu peux jouer sur le focus en le mettant ailleur...  :D  

Reply

Marsh Posté le 09-01-2005 à 18:57:07    

le focus?

Reply

Marsh Posté le 09-01-2005 à 20:32:55    

Le problème que tu rencontres te fait apprendre une leçon : Toujours, mais alors toujours mettre un petit bouton "go" pour  aller sur la page désirée. Avec ton truc, si on a le malheur de vouloir sélectionner une page avec le clavier, on est foutu. Pareil avec la molette comme tu peux le voir. Donc met un petit bouton à côté ;)
 
Aussi ton site utilise des frames, ce qui est très dangereux : problèmes de référencement sur moteurs de recherches, problèmes avec boutons précédents/suivants, impossible de bookmarker une page spécifique, etc...


---------------
W3C : Leading the Web to Its Full Potential... - Membre du W3C l33t club
Reply

Marsh Posté le 09-01-2005 à 20:33:07    

merci du conseil...ça n'est pas mon site, juste un exemple que je rencontre souvent.
Et je veux faire un site avec le meme type de menu...sans les frames.


Message édité par kameha le 09-01-2005 à 20:34:32
Reply

Marsh Posté le 09-01-2005 à 21:41:07    

au fait, ça me revient mais j'ai deja vu des menus qui se deselectionnaient automatiquement...Si quelqu'un connait cela, ça m'evitera de mettre un bouton qui oblige le 2 clicks plutot qu'1


Message édité par kameha le 09-01-2005 à 21:43:21
Reply

Marsh Posté le 10-01-2005 à 09:51:28    

Non, tu es obligé de mettre un bouton, parce que sinon on peux pas sélectionner les trucs via le clavier ou autre dispositif de sélection. Ca sert à rien de vouloir supprimer un click si pleins de gens ne pourront plus utiliser ton truc comme ils le veulent.

Reply

Marsh Posté le 10-01-2005 à 09:54:03    

kameha a écrit :

au fait, ça me revient mais j'ai deja vu des menus qui se deselectionnaient automatiquement...Si quelqu'un connait cela, ça m'evitera de mettre un bouton qui oblige le 2 clicks plutot qu'1


 
Mettre un bouton n'oblige pas à faire deux clicks.

Reply

Marsh Posté le 10-01-2005 à 10:42:47    

+1 pour les remarques sur l'ajout d'un bouton "Go" plutôt que d'utiliser l'évènement onChange.
 
Sinon, pour que ton menu perde le focus (ie. soit désélectionné) il faut que la page que tu charges donne ce focus à un autre élément.
 
Pour cela, tu peux utiliser l'évènement onLoad de l'élément <body>.


Message édité par Bidem le 10-01-2005 à 10:43:46
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ed